Transaction 37cc726a2afcebb96af830fecf11281101eba0eb7ecb2ae3060826de3fb8dc45

4 Input
2 Outputs
  • 37cc726a2afcebb96af830fecf11281101eba0eb7ecb2ae3060826de3fb8dc45:0
  • value  1035051460
    address  1AyE2845rZqTX438WQG69h8oGVrsQXSCFs
  • 37cc726a2afcebb96af830fecf11281101eba0eb7ecb2ae3060826de3fb8dc45:1
  • value  105272229
    address  1DDWpmPinYLbYZkvi2EstYgkEj5XpPqtDK